Figure 4 Electrocardiogram rhythm strip demonstrating polymorphic ventricular tachycardia. The single-lead rhythm strip documents the onset of polymorphic ventricular tachycardia with a ventricular rate of approximately 150 bpm, characterized by substantially widened (> 240 ms) and deformed QRS complexes approaching a sine-wave pattern, accompanied by severe repolarization abnormalities secondary to global myocardial electrical instability. This rhythm carries a high risk of degeneration into ventricular fibrillation, which subsequently developed.
